Samsung Galaxy S6 may have improved Touch Wiz interface

Samsung is a dynamic company and does not believe in inertia and wants the things moving towards better shape. We may expect a new TouchWiz interface in Galaxy S6 which is an improvement over the previous interface.

Samsung will unveil the new series of flagships at MWC in March 2015. In its Galaxy S6 it is going to have 5.2 inches QHD super AMOLED screen with 64 bit, Snapdragon 810 processor coupled with 3 GB RAM, 20 MP camera with OIS camera and ability to resist water. Beside that it is have new designed appearance and metal body.
